Soy: It does a body good post-menopausal women are at risk of developing the bone disease osteoporosis. However, new studies now show that women can put their risk by consuming soy. To lower your risk of osteoporosis and increase your bone density in your spine, consume 40 grams of soy protein a day. A recent study found that women who consumed soy with isoflavones maintained bone density, while those who didn't consume isoflavones actually lost bone density. In general, if you substitute soy for animal protein, you will lose less calcium from your bones because animal protein causes calcium loss.
